City Connection has kept their word by officially launching “Farland Saga I&II: Saturn Tribute” in Japan today, as they announced back in February. Individual ports of this game are now accessible in Japan on Nintendo Switch, PlayStation 5, PlayStation 4, Xbox One, and PC platforms. Additionally, a physical collection is available for the first two consoles.
The individual Steam platforms for Farland Saga and its sequel, Farland Saga II, can be found globally, complete with English descriptions, although they currently only provide Japanese language options. On the day of launch, City Connection released a new press statement in Japanese, but we observed that one of the images for Farland Saga II features an English menu for the ports’ updated functions such as Rewind and Quick Save/Load. Whether this might indicate a future release of an actual English localization is uncertain at this point.
